Boyd Autobody in Penticton target of string of criminal activity

Car destroyed by early morning fire inside Boyd Autobody in Penticton. Angela Jung / Global Okanagan

PENTICTON B.C. — It’s been a tough week for the owners of Boyd Autobody and Glass in Penticton. The repair shop has been the target of three escalating criminal attacks since Monday.

The latest happened early Friday morning, when a car inside the shop was torched. Fire officials got the call just before 5 a.m. and believe the blaze is suspicious.

“When crews gained access to shop they found the car fully engulfed in flames,” says Penticton fire chief, Wayne Williams. “Crews were able to confine the fire to one corner of the building but the smoke damage inside is considerable.”

Boyd Autobody owner, Methal Abougoush, says he wasn’t shocked when he got the call about the fire because of two incidents earlier in the week. Someone attempted to light fireworks inside the shop Monday and someone smashed a windows Wednesday.

Story continues below advertisement

RCMP are investigating. Abougoush says he has handed over surveillance footage to police.
